Was sind und wozu dienen PLC- und PAC-Steuerungen?

Programmierbare Logiksteuerungen

Viele von Ihnen haben sicher schon von PLC-Steuerungen gehört. Besonders für Personen, die mit Automatisierung zu tun haben, ist dies ein sehr vertrauter Begriff. Nur wenige wissen jedoch, dass unser Angebot seit kurzem um eine breite Palette von PLC- und PAC-Steuerungen der Marke HCFA erweitert wurde. Wir laden Sie ein, den Artikel zu lesen und unser Angebot kennenzulernen. PLC-Steuerungen sind programmierbare Logiksteuerungen (engl. Programmable Logic Controllers). Dies sind Geräte, die in verschiedenen Bereichen wie Industrie, Energie, Gebäudeautomatisierung oder Transport eingesetzt werden. Ihre Funktionsweise kann mit der des menschlichen Gehirns verglichen werden, wobei der Steuerer – ähnlich wie das Gehirn – ein in seinem Speicher gespeichertes Programm ausführt. Basierend auf der Analyse verschiedener Eingangssignale (digital und analog) wird ein entsprechender Steuerungsalgorithmus für eine Maschine/einen Prozess ausgeführt. Dieser Algorithmus wird vom Programmierer in Form eines Programms geschrieben. Als Ergebnis dieses Prozesses steuert der PLC-Steuerer Aktoren wie Ventile, Motoren, Antriebe, Roboter usw., um ein bestimmtes Ziel zu erreichen. Dieses Ziel kann z.B. die Produktion eines bestimmten Produkts, die Aufrechterhaltung einer bestimmten Raumtemperatur, das Dosieren und Mischen von Halbzeugen oder das Verpacken von Produkten sein. Der erste PLC-Steuerer wurde 1969 von der Firma Modicon entwickelt und eingeführt. Später revolutionierte dieses Gerät den Markt der Steuerungssysteme und ersetzte die zuvor verwendeten Relais-Schütz-Schaltungen. Ein kleines Gerät ersetzte die Arbeit von Hunderten oder sogar Tausenden zusammenarbeitenden Relais und Schützen. Der PLC-Steuerer war ein universelles Gerät, da der Steuerungsalgorithmus durch Änderungen im Programm des Steuerers an verschiedene Maschinen angepasst werden konnte, ohne die Hardwarestruktur des Steuerers zu modifizieren.
Aus welchen Komponenten besteht ein PLC-Steuerer?
Ein PLC-Steuerer besteht aus mehreren grundlegenden Komponenten:
  • Zentraleinheit CPU – verantwortlich für die Ausführung des Steuerungsalgorithmus,
  • Speicher – der das Programm speichert,
  • Eingänge/Ausgänge – in entsprechender Konfiguration,
  • Kommunikationsports – ermöglichen das Hochladen des Programms und die Kommunikation mit anderen Geräten.
Im Laufe der Jahre und mit der Entwicklung von Steuerungssystemen stellte sich heraus, dass die bisherigen Lösungen auf Basis von PLC-Steuerern nicht ausreichten. Die Einführung des Konzepts Industrie 4.0, die Informatisierung industrieller Anlagen, die Erfassung und Verarbeitung von Daten aus vielen Maschinen, die in verschiedenen Standards und Kommunikationsprotokollen arbeiten, sowie die Datensicherheit erforderten die Einführung neuer, leistungsfähigerer, multiprotokollfähiger Geräte. Diese neuen Geräte wurden als PAC (engl. Programmable Automation Controller) bezeichnet. Ein PAC-Steuerer ist ein Gerät, dessen Funktionalität der traditioneller PLC-Steuerer sehr ähnlich ist, jedoch neue Möglichkeiten in der Steuerung und Integration mit anderen Automatisierungsgeräten bietet. Diese Steuerer zeichnen sich durch deutlich mehr Speicher, leistungsfähigere Prozessoren, Modularität und Multithreading aus und können daher für umfangreiche und komplexe Automatisierungssysteme eingesetzt werden. Sie ermöglichen die Programmierung in mehreren verschiedenen Programmiersprachen. Ein wesentlicher Unterschied zwischen einem PAC- und einem PLC-Steuerer ist die Möglichkeit der Erweiterung des Steuerungssystems, integrierte Diagnosefunktionen und die Fähigkeit, in kontinuierlichen Systemen zu arbeiten. Systeme auf Basis von PAC-Steuerern zeichnen sich auch durch Flexibilität und die Möglichkeit der Erweiterung um viele Kommunikationsmodule aus, die lokal oder verteilt arbeiten können.

PLC-/PAC-Steuerer der Marke HCFA

Eines der Flaggschiffprodukte der Marke HCFA sind fortschrittliche, multiprotokollfähige PLC-Steuerer und PAC-Steuerer mit integrierten Motion-Control-Funktionen. Diese Steuerer können in vielen Fällen die Funktion eines fortschrittlichen Bewegungssteuerers mit Unterstützung für bis zu 256 reale EtherCAT-Achsen übernehmen. Das Angebot an Steuerern umfasst drei Produktserien: – PLC-Steuerer der M300-Serie – PLC-Steuerer der M500-Serie – PAC-Steuerer der Q- und QP-Serie

PLC-Steuerer der M-Serie





PLC-Steuerer der M-Serie sind wirtschaftliche, dennoch schnelle und kompakte Steuerer, die sich ideal für einfachere und anspruchsvolle Antriebs- und Prozessanwendungen eignen.Merkmale der PLC-Steuerer der M-Serie:
  • Kompakt und schnell – die Ausführungszeit einer einzelnen Anweisung beträgt nur 5 ns
  • Unterstützung mehrerer Programmiersprachen – LD/FBD, ST sowie C/C++ (gemäß IEC61131-3-Standard)
  • Multiprotokoll-Kommunikation – u.a. Free Protocol, Modbus RTU/TCP, CANopen, EtherNet/IP, EtherCAT
  • Unterstützung von Funktionsblöcken für die Bewegungssteuerung (Motion-Funktionen) gemäß PLCOpen2.0 – u.a. mehrdimensionale Synchronisation, elektronische Kurvenscheiben, Achsengruppierung, Funktionen wie fliegende Säge, Drehmesser, lineare/kreisrunde/sphärische Interpolation
  • CNC-Funktionen – Unterstützung von G-Code, M-Code (ausgewählte Modelle)
  • Integrierte schnelle Impulseingänge/-ausgänge mit 200 kHz für die Encoder-Ansteuerung und Achsensteuerung (u.a. Schrittmotoren, Servoantriebe usw.)
  • Achsensteuerung – von 8 bis 64 reale EtherCAT-Achsen (bis zu 128 Slave-Geräte) und von 4 bis 8 impulsgesteuerte Achsen
  • Erweiterungsmöglichkeit der I/O durch Erweiterungsmodule der HCMX-Serie oder über Signalinseln der HCQX-D4- und HCNXE-Serie.
  • Kostenlose und umfangreiche Programmierumgebung – SysCtrl Studio-Software
   Abb. 1 PLC-Steuerer der M-Serie – Kommunikationsmöglichkeiten.    

PAC-Steuerer der Q- und QP-Serie

  Eget quis mi enim, leo lacinia pharetra, semper. Eget in volutpat mollis at volutpat lectus velit, sed auctor. Porttitor fames arcu quis fusce augue enim. Quis at habitant diam at. Suscipit tristique risus, at donec. In turpis vel et quam imperdiet. Ipsum molestie aliquet sodales id est ac volutpat.Mi tincidunt elit, id quisque ligula ac diam, amet. Vel etiam suspendisse morbi eleifend faucibus eget vestibulum felis. Dictum quis montes, sit sit. Tellus aliquam enim urna, etiam. Mauris posuere vulputate arcu amet, vitae nisi, tellus tincidunt. At feugiat sapien varius id. Tristique odio senectus nam posuere ornare leo metus, ultricies. Blandit duis ultricies vulputate morbi feugiat cras placerat elit. Aliquam tellus lorem sed ac. Montes, sed mattis pellentesque suscipit accumsan. Cursus viverra aenean magna risus elementum faucibus molestie pellentesque. Arcu ultricies sed mauris vestibulum. Eget quis mi enim, leo lacinia pharetra, semper. Eget in volutpat mollis at volutpat lectus velit, sed auctor. Porttitor fames arcu quis fusce augue enim. Quis at habitant diam at. Suscipit tristique risus, at donec. In turpis vel et quam imperdiet. Ipsum molestie aliquet sodales id est ac volutpat.Mi tincidunt elit, id quisque ligula ac diam, amet. Vel etiam suspendisse morbi eleifend faucibus eget vestibulum felis. Dictum quis montes, sit sit. Tellus aliquam enim urna, etiam. Mauris posuere vulputate arcu amet, vitae nisi, tellus tincidunt. At feugiat sapien varius id. Tristique odio senectus nam posuere ornare leo metus, ultricies. Blandit duis ultricies vulputate morbi feugiat cras placerat elit. Aliquam tellus lorem sed ac. Montes, sed mattis pellentesque suscipit accumsan. Cursus viverra aenean magna risus elementum faucibus molestie pellentesque. Arcu ultricies sed mauris vestibulum.

 
Merkmale der PAC-Steuerer der Q-/QP-Serie:
 
  • Unterstützung mehrerer Programmiersprachen – IL, LD, FBD, ST, SFC, CFC (gemäß IEC61131-3- und PLCOpen 2.0-Standard);
  • Multiprotokoll-Kommunikation – u.a. Free Protocol, Modbus RTU/TCP, CANopen, EtherNet/IP, EtherCAT, OPC UA;
  • Steuerer mit leistungsstarken ARM-, Intel Celeron-, Intel i5- und Intel i7-Prozessoren (je nach Steuererversion);
  • Großer Speicher: bis zu 128 MB Programmspeicher, bis zu 128 MB Flash, bis zu 8 GB RAM und Unterstützung für SSDs bis zu 64 GB;
  • Unterstützung von Funktionsblöcken für die Bewegungssteuerung (SoftMotion) gemäß PLCOpen2.0 – u.a. mehrdimensionale Synchronisation, elektronische Kurvenscheiben, Achsengruppierung, Funktionen wie fliegende Säge, Drehmesser, lineare/kreisrunde/sphärische Interpolation;
  • CNC-Funktionen – Unterstützung von G-Code, M-Code;
  • Unterstützung der Kinematik von Industrierobotern;
  • Integrierte schnelle Impulseingänge/-ausgänge mit 200 kHz für die Encoder-Ansteuerung und Achsensteuerung (u.a. Schrittmotoren, Servoantriebe usw.);
  • Achsensteuerung – von 8 bis 256 reale EtherCAT-Achsen und bis zu 8 impulsgesteuerte Achsen;
  • Möglichkeit zur Erstellung sehr umfangreicher verteilter Systeme – Unterstützung für bis zu 65.536 EtherCAT-Slave-Geräte;
  • Erweiterungsmöglichkeit der I/O durch Erweiterungsmodule der HCQX-D4-Serie oder über Signalinseln der HCQX-D4- und HCNXE-Serie;
  • Programmierumgebung – CODESYS v.3.5 oder HCP WORKS 3 (kostenlos).
  Abb. 8 Aufbau eines PAC-Steuerers am Beispiel des HCQ5P-1500-U4-Steuerers.    
Zusammenfassung
  Eget quis mi enim, leo lacinia pharetra, semper. Eget in volutpat mollis at volutpat lectus velit, sed auctor. Porttitor fames arcu quis fusce augue enim. Quis at habitant diam at. Suscipit tristique risus, at donec. In turpis vel et quam imperdiet. Ipsum molestie aliquet sodales id est ac volutpat.Mi tincidunt elit, id quisque ligula ac diam, amet. Vel etiam suspendisse morbi eleifend faucibus eget vestibulum felis. Dictum quis montes, sit sit. Tellus aliquam enim urna, etiam. Mauris posuere vulputate arcu amet, vitae nisi, tellus tincidunt. At feugiat sapien varius id. Tristique odio senectus nam posuere ornare leo metus, ultricies. Blandit duis ultricies vulputate morbi feugiat cras placerat elit. Aliquam tellus lorem sed ac. Montes, sed mattis pellentesque suscipit accumsan. Cursus viverra aenean magna risus elementum faucibus molestie pellentesque. Arcu ultricies sed mauris vestibulum.

Fragen richten Sie bitte an:

automatyka@pivexin-tech.pl

Tel. 32 412 30 45